In reply to: Rotate/Adjust Pics in WP PostI use chrome for browsing and if you look at the image you posted above and ‘right click/inspect element’ you can look at the code for that image and although the file name shows the numbers the right way around, when you hover over the highlighted image code a little pop up window shows the actual image is listed as 480 wide and 640 tall as displayed.
You can also click ctrl and the letter U (to view source code) and scroll down to line 192 to look at the code for the image which displays properly on the blogspot link but not on the other one!
